On season start up I manually dose the pool to bring FC up to my target and then set the flow rate, using a pinch valve on the Liquidator to a level that will replace the daily lose. This of course take a few days to dial it in, but I know after a couple of years that the pinch valve will need to be somewhere between 3 to 4 on the pinch valve setting scale. I usually refill the Liquidator with three or for gallons once the chlorine level reaches 2 inches from the bottom of the tank. So, under normal circumstances I have 2 to five gallons in the Liquidator. If I plan on being away longer than a week, then I will fill it up to the max level stated in the Liquidator operating manual.
